Technical Field

[0001] This invention relates to the field of screw production equipment technology, and in particular to an oiling device for screw production. Background Technology

[0002] Screws are tools that utilize the physical and mathematical principles of inclined planes, circular rotation, and friction to gradually tighten objects and machine parts. Screws play a vital role in industry; in fact, it could be said that as long as industry exists on Earth, the function of screws will remain important. Currently, screws are oiled according to different usage environment requirements before being weighed, packaged, and shipped.

[0003] In order to ensure that the screws are fully oiled while preventing contamination and reducing waste, existing screw oiling equipment usually uses a filtration structure to filter out and collect excess oil.

[0004] For example, Chinese Patent Publication No. CN218554575U discloses "an oiling device for screw production". Its receiving oil filter cylinder filters the oil from the screws, reducing the dripping of oil outside the oil collection tank, thereby reducing the generation of dirt on the oiling device and playing the role of oil recovery. However, in actual use, the screws after oil filtration still need to be manually removed or an additional material handling device needs to be added, which not only increases the operating cost of the equipment, but also further increases the production cost if an additional material handling device is added. [0027] Reference Figure 1-4 An oiling device for screw production includes an oiling device 1, a rotating mechanism 2, and a filter box 3. The rotating mechanism 2 is rotatably mounted on the oiling device 1 and is fixedly connected to multiple filter boxes 3 via multiple support plates 4. A filter screen plate 5 is provided below the filter box 3, and one side of the filter screen plate 5 is rotatably connected to the support plate 4.

[0028] A reset mechanism 6 is provided between the filter screen plate 5 and the support plate 4, and a discharge assembly 7 for unloading is provided between the filter screen plate 5 and the oiling device 1.

[0029] In this invention, in order to automatically remove the screws after filtering, a material unloading component 7 is provided between the filter screen plate 5 and the oiling device 1. When the filter box 3 rotates to a certain position, the material unloading component 7 will cause the filter screen plate 5 and the filter box 3 to be misaligned, and the screws in the filter box 3 will be poured out. The filter screen plate 5 will be reset by the reset mechanism 6, so as to realize the cyclic use of the filter box 3.

[0030] Furthermore, in this embodiment, a connecting part 8 is fixedly provided on one side of the filter screen plate 5. The connecting part 8 is rotatably connected to the support plate 4 so that the filter screen plate 5 rotates around the connecting part 8 as the center, and is misaligned with the filter box 3 to form a gap, so that the screw falls out from the gap to achieve automatic unloading.

[0031] Furthermore, in this embodiment, the unloading assembly 7 includes a protrusion 71 fixedly disposed below the filter screen plate 5, and a stop bar 72 fixedly disposed on the inner wall of the oiling device 1 and cooperating with the protrusion 71. When the filter box 3 rotates to the upper end of the stop bar 72, the protrusion 71 contacts the stop bar 72. As the filter box 3 continues to rotate, the filter screen plate 5 will rotate around the connecting part 8 as the center because the protrusion 71 is blocked. During this process, the protrusion 71 will gradually move toward the rotating mechanism 2 until it separates from the stop bar 72. In order to facilitate the movement of the protrusion 71, in some embodiments, the stop bar 72 can be set with an included angle greater than 90 degrees, preferably 135 degrees.

[0032] It should be noted that in some embodiments, the reset mechanism 6 includes a sector gear 61 rotatably mounted on the support plate 4, and the connecting part 8 is a transmission gear meshing with the sector gear 61. The support plate 4 is provided with a reset component that cooperates with the sector gear 61, so that when the filter screen plate 5 rotates around the connecting part 8, the connecting part 8 rotates accordingly and drives the sector gear 61 to rotate. When the filter screen plate 5 is no longer subjected to external force, the reset component resets the sector gear 61, the connecting part 8, and the filter screen plate 5.

[0033] In some embodiments, the reset assembly includes an L-shaped plate 62 fixedly connected to the sector gear 61, and a U-shaped plate 63 fixedly disposed on the support plate 4 to cooperate with the L-shaped plate 62. A spring 64 is provided between the L-shaped plate 62 and the U-shaped plate 63 so that when the filter screen plate 5 rotates around the connecting part 8, the connecting part 8 rotates accordingly and drives the sector gear 61 to rotate. When the sector gear 61 rotates, the L-shaped plate 62 will compress the spring 64 so that when the filter screen plate 5 is no longer subjected to external force, the spring 64 will have a tendency to reset, causing the sector gear 61 to rotate in the opposite direction, thereby driving the connecting part 8 and the filter screen plate 5 to rotate and reset.

[0034] In some embodiments, both the L-shaped plate 62 and the U-shaped plate 63 are provided with fixing posts 65 for inserting the spring 64 to prevent the spring 64 from falling off or popping out.

[0035] In some other embodiments, a protective plate 66 is fixedly provided at the lower end of the U-shaped plate 63 to prevent the spring 64 from falling off or popping out.

[0036] Furthermore, in one shoe embodiment, a guide part 31 is fixedly provided inside the filter box 3. The upper end of the guide part 31 is an inclined surface, which guides the screw after oiling, so that the oil falls down along the inclined surface.

[0037] In detail, in this embodiment, a discharge port 32 is provided between the lower end of the guide part 31 and the bottom of the filter box 3. When the filter screen 5 is opened due to obstruction, there will be a material discharge gap between it and the filter box 3. As the filter box 3 rotates, the gap gradually increases. When the protrusion 71 separates from the stop bar 72, the gap reaches its maximum. However, the filter screen 5 is still not completely separated from the filter box 3, resulting in some screws remaining on the filter screen 5. In order to solve this problem, a guide part 31 is provided in the filter box 3 to form a discharge port 32. The area of ​​the discharge port 32 is smaller than the area when the gap is at its maximum value. When the gap is at its maximum value, the discharge port 32 is completely contained within the gap, so that the screws all move down along the discharge port 32 without leaving any residue.

[0038] In some embodiments, in order to facilitate the conveying of the removed screws, a through groove is provided on one side of the oiling device 1, and a conveying device that cooperates with the filter box 3 is provided in the through groove. The conveying device can be a conveyor belt or the like.

[0039] Working method: During operation, the oiling device 1 applies oil to the screws. After oiling, the screws fall into the filter box 3 to filter the oil. The rotating mechanism 2 drives the filter box 3 to rotate, allowing the new filter box 3 to continue receiving material. This is existing technology and will not be elaborated further. When the rotating mechanism 2 moves the filter box 3 above the baffle 72, the protrusion 71 contacts the baffle 72. The rotating mechanism 2 continues to drive the filter box 3 to rotate, and the protrusion 71 contacts the baffle 72, causing the filter screen plate 5 to rotate around the connecting part 8 as the center, creating a gap with the filter box 3, allowing the screw to fall and unload material. The connecting part 8 rotates accordingly and drives the sector gear 61 to rotate. The L-shaped plate 62 compresses the spring 64. When the filter box 3 rotates until the protrusion 71 separates from the baffle 72, the spring 64 tends to reset, causing the sector gear 61 to rotate in the opposite direction, thereby driving the connecting part 8 and the filter screen plate 5 to rotate and reset, so that the filter box 3 can continue to receive material after unloading.
